    Word of advice, don't wear most common brands of cycling masks. They are not suitable for covid purposes as they have a valve that opens to let your breath out unfiltered. They are almost as bad as wearing nothing of not worse because you may be jetting the virus further through the narrow valve than when breathing out in a wider outlet. 

    This also applied to proper, work PPE masks to the various standards if there's a plastic valve housing on it. There's many masks being sold for covid with such valves so it is up to everyone not to buy or use them for covid infection reduction. If it does reduce your risks it's potentially increasing other's risks.

    You can buy various plastic and silicone forms for use with any mask to make them perform better. Ridiculous plastic cage things to pull the mask fabric away from contacting your face in the middle but probably more uncomfortable with them.

    One interesting silicone form was for the edge of the mask on the nose. It lifts the fabric,  seals the gap and ducts the breath to the side away from glasses.  They're selling on amazon. I do wonder how well they work.
